Wether Hill
670m (2199ft)


Wether Hill is in The Far Eastern Fells, The Lake District, Cumbria, England

Wether Hill lost it's 'Nuttall' status in March 2012 because the ground 500m to the SSW - Wether Hill (South Top) was found to be higher. However it remains a 'Wainwright'.

James Hughes bagged it on September 17th, 2024 [from/via/route] c112 Bonscale Pike & Wether Hill from Howtown [weather] Overcast with sunny spells. Blustery on tops at times. Cool on tops, but good walking temperature. - Road closed to Howtown so started walk other side of Barton Fell lengthening walk. Gentle climbs with bleak landscape over High Street Range. Good views of Ullswater. Long walk back from Steel End descent. Wainwright sitting stone overlooking Ullswater.
